import torch | |
from torch.autograd import Variable | |
import torch.nn as nn | |
import torch.nn.functional as F | |
import torch.optim as optim | |
import torchvision | |
import torchvision.transforms as transforms | |
import torchsample as ts | |
from torchsample.modules import ModuleTrainer | |
from torchsample.metrics import * | |
import time | |
EPOCHS = 350 | |
BATCH_SIZE = 64 | |
GPU = False | |
# Set up the dataset | |
normalize = transforms.Compose( | |
[transforms.ToTensor(), | |
transforms.Normalize((0.5, 0.5, 0.5), (0.5, 0.5, 0.5))]) | |
train = torchvision.datasets.CIFAR10(root='./data', train=True, | |
download=True, transform=normalize) | |
trainloader = torch.utils.data.DataLoader(train, batch_size=BATCH_SIZE, | |
shuffle=True, num_workers=2) | |
test = torchvision.datasets.CIFAR10(root='./data', train=False, | |
download=True, transform=normalize) | |
testloader = torch.utils.data.DataLoader(test, batch_size=BATCH_SIZE, | |
shuffle=False, num_workers=2) | |
classes = ('plane', 'car', 'bird', 'cat', | |
'deer', 'dog', 'frog', 'horse', 'ship', 'truck') | |
class Net(nn.Module): | |
def __init__(self): | |
super(Net, self).__init__() | |
# 1 input image channel, 6 output channels, 5x5 square convolution kernel | |
self.conv1 = nn.Conv2d(in_channels=3, out_channels=16, kernel_size=5, stride=1, padding=2) # out res 32x32 | |
self.pool1 = nn.MaxPool2d(stride=2, kernel_size=2) | |
self.conv2 = nn.Conv2d(in_channels=16, out_channels=20, kernel_size=5, stride=1, padding=2) # out res 16x16 | |
self.pool2 = nn.MaxPool2d(stride=2, kernel_size=2) | |
self.conv3 = nn.Conv2d(in_channels=20, out_channels=20, kernel_size=5, stride=1, padding=2) # out res 16x16 | |
self.pool3 = nn.MaxPool2d(stride=2, kernel_size=2) | |
self.fin = nn.Linear(4 * 4 * 20, 10) | |
def forward(self, x): | |
x = F.relu(self.conv1(x)) | |
x = self.pool1(x) | |
x = F.relu(self.conv2(x)) | |
x = self.pool2(x) | |
x = F.relu(self.conv3(x)) | |
x = self.pool3(x) | |
x = x.view(-1, self.num_flat_features(x)) # flatten | |
x = self.fin(x) | |
x = F.softmax(x) | |
return x | |
def num_flat_features(self, x): | |
size = x.size()[1:] # all dimensions except the batch dimension | |
num_features = 1 | |
for s in size: | |
num_features *= s | |
return num_features | |
model = Net() | |
if GPU: | |
model = model.cuda(0) | |
print(model) | |
trainer = ModuleTrainer(model) | |
trainer.compile( | |
loss=nn.CrossEntropyLoss(), | |
optimizer='adam', | |
# optimizer=optim.SGD(model.parameters(), lr=0.1, momentum=0.9, weight_decay=0.001), | |
metrics=[CategoricalAccuracy()]) | |
trainer.fit_loader(trainloader, testloader, | |
num_epoch=EPOCHS, | |
verbose=1, | |
cuda_device= 0 if GPU else -1) |
